Hastelloy fasteners are hardware components, including bolts, screws, nuts, washers, and studs, made from Hastelloy, a group of nickel-based alloys renowned for their outstanding corrosion resistance and high strength in extreme environments. These alloys primarily consist of nickel, chromium, and molybdenum, with other added elements like cobalt, iron, and tungsten, depending on the specific grade.

Advantages of Hastelloy Fasteners

Hastelloy Fasteners
  • Exceptional Corrosion Resistance: Hastelloy fasteners offer superior resistance to corrosion, making them ideal for use in harsh and aggressive environments, such as chemical processing plants and marine applications.
  • High-Temperature Resistance: These fasteners can withstand high temperatures, maintaining their mechanical properties and strength even in extreme heat, which is essential for aerospace and power generation industries.
  • Excellent Mechanical Strength: Hastelloy fasteners are known for their excellent mechanical strength, providing reliable and robust fastening solutions for demanding applications.
  • Wide Range of Alloys: Available in various Hastelloy grades, these fasteners can be tailored to meet specific requirements, ensuring optimal performance in different environments and applications.
  • Versatility: Hastelloy fasteners can be used in various industries, including chemical processing, oil and gas, marine, and aerospace.
  • Resistance to Pitting and Crevice Corrosion: Hastelloy fasteners are highly resistant to pitting and crevice corrosion, which can be particularly problematic in chloride-rich and acidic environments.
  • Low Maintenance: Due to their exceptional resistance to corrosion and wear, Hastelloy fasteners require minimal maintenance, reducing downtime and operational costs.
  • Longevity: The combination of high strength, corrosion resistance, and durability ensures that Hastelloy fasteners have a long service life, providing reliable performance over extended periods.

Hastelloy Fasteners Uses

Application Industry

Hastelloy fasteners are crucial in various industrial applications thanks to their exceptional corrosion resistance and high-strength properties. Commonly found in industries such as chemical processing, oil and gas, aerospace, marine, and pharmaceuticals, these fasteners are trusted to withstand harsh environments. In chemical processing plants, Hastelloy fasteners are utilized in equipment such as reactors, vessels, and pipelines, which resist corrosion from corrosive chemicals and acids.

Chemical Processing

Aviation Industry

Petro Chemical Industry

Oil and Gas Industry

  • Chemical Processing Industry: Hastelloy fasteners are used in equipment such as reactors, heat exchangers, and columns, which are corrosive chemicals at high temperatures.
  • Oil and Gas Industry: They are used in offshore drilling rigs, pipelines, and refineries due to their ability to withstand harsh marine environments and resist corrosion from sour gas and other aggressive substances.
  • Aerospace Industry: These fasteners are employed in jet engines, gas turbine engines, and other high-performance applications where high-temperature resistance and durability are critical.
  • Pharmaceutical Industry: Hastelloy fasteners are used in equipment that must maintain purity and resist corrosion from strong cleaning agents and solvents.
  • Marine Industry: They are utilized in marine environments, including shipbuilding and underwater pipelines, where corrosion resistance to seawater and marine atmospheres is essential.
  • Power Generation: Hastelloy fasteners are used in nuclear and fossil fuel power plants, particularly in components exposed to high temperatures and corrosive conditions.
  • Pulp and Paper Industry: These fasteners are used in equipment exposed to bleaching chemicals and other corrosive substances in paper production.
  • Environmental Technology: They are used in pollution control equipment, such as flue gas desulfurization systems, where they must resist corrosive gases and high temperatures.
  • Food and Beverage Industry: Hastelloy fasteners are used in processing equipment that must withstand frequent cleaning and exposure to corrosive substances while ensuring product purity.

How to Choose the Right Hastelloy Fasteners

  1. Identify Application Requirements: Determine the operating conditions such as temperature, pressure, corrosion exposure, mechanical loads, and other factors that the fasteners will be subjected to.
  2. Select the Appropriate Hastelloy Alloy: Hastelloy fasteners are available in various alloys, each offering different levels of corrosion resistance, strength, and temperature stability. Choose an alloy that best matches the requirements of your application.
  3. Consider Fastener Type and Configuration: Determine the type of fasteners needed (bolts, screws, nuts, washers, etc.) and their specifications (size, thread type, head style, etc.) based on the specific assembly requirements and structural considerations.
  4. Evaluate Environmental Factors: Consider the exposure to corrosive substances, such as acids, alkalis, saltwater, and chemicals, to select Hastelloy fasteners with the appropriate corrosion resistance and durability.
  5. Assess Load Requirements: Determine the mechanical loads, stresses, and vibration levels the fasteners will experience during operation to ensure they have the necessary strength, fatigue resistance, and reliability.
  6. Check Compatibility: Ensure compatibility with other materials in the assembly to prevent galvanic corrosion or other forms of material degradation. Consider using isolation techniques or compatible coatings if necessary.
  7. Verify Compliance with Standards: Ensure the selected Hastelloy fasteners meet relevant industry standards and specifications (e.g., ASTM, ASME) for quality, performance, and dimensional accuracy.
  8. Consider Cost: Evaluate the cost of the fasteners in terms of their performance and lifespan. While Hastelloy fasteners may have a higher initial cost than other materials, they can save long-term costs by reducing maintenance and replacement costs in corrosive environments.
  9. Consult with Experts: If you need clarification on which Hastelloy fasteners are best suited for your application, consult with engineers, metallurgists, or specialists in fastener selection to get expert advice and recommendations.
  10. Review Supplier Reputation: Choose a reputable supplier or manufacturer with a track record of providing high-quality Hastelloy fasteners and reliable customer support to ensure product availability, consistency, and timely delivery.

How Do I Maintain Hastelloy Fasteners?

To maintain Hastelloy fasteners, regularly inspect for signs of corrosion or wear. Clean with a mild detergent and soft cloth to remove contaminants. Avoid harsh chemicals and abrasive materials. Consider periodic lubrication to prevent galling and ensure proper tightening torque during installation.

Are Hastelloy Fasteners Suitable For Hygienic And Sanitary Applications?

Yes, Hastelloy fasteners are suitable for hygienic and sanitary applications due to their excellent corrosion resistance, which includes resistance to pitting, crevice corrosion, and stress corrosion cracking. They also offer high mechanical strength and durability, which is ideal for environments requiring cleanliness and reliability, such as pharmaceutical, food processing, and chemical industries.

How Do I Select The Right Hastelloy Fasteners For My Application?

To select the right Hastelloy fasteners, consider factors like corrosion resistance (specifically against the intended environment), temperature requirements, mechanical strength needed, and compatibility with other materials in the assembly. Choose from various grades (e.g., C-276, C-22) based on these factors to ensure optimal performance and longevity in your application.

Are Hastelloy Fasteners Recyclable?

Yes, Hastelloy fasteners are recyclable. Hastelloy alloys, known for their corrosion resistance and durability, can be recycled and reused, contributing to sustainability efforts in various industries. Recycling Hastelloy helps conserve resources and reduce environmental impact while maintaining the alloy’s high-performance characteristics.
